Kevin Redon 6268322221 cardem: ensure VCC_PHONE is floating
this change is mainly relevant for the SIMtrace board, but also
affects the others.
First we ensure VCC_PHONE is not forwarded to VCC_SIM because the
card could affect the signal (card could draw too much current or
feed back current in).
next we disable VCC_SIM. the card slot does not need to be
powered, and the FPF2019 leaks current back to VCC_PHONE, even
with forwarding disabled (the reverse current protection only
kicks in when VCC_PHONE is briefly shorted to ground, but still
leaks 0.6V).
enable the ADC channels normally used to measure VCC, even if
not used. the dedicated ADC pins leak current when left
unconfigured. enabling them puts them in high impedance.

Harald Welte e42492971e pio_it.c: Permit repeated calls to PIO_ConfigureIt()
The original code assumes that calls to PIO_ConfigureIt() are only
made once e.g. during board start-up.  Hoewever, we call those
at USB SetConfiguration time, when we know which particular hardware
function we are supposed to perform.   This means that after the host
has issued SetConfiguration more than a given number of times, the
code will assert() due to overflow of the static array.

Let's check if we already have allocated an array slot for a given pin
and reuse that allocated array bucket rather than allocating new ones
for the same pin.

Harald Welte 37220cce25 Disable interrupts during EEFC_ReadUniqueID()
Reading the Unique ID from flash is a rather tricky procedure: After the
STUI command has been issued, we cannot read normal flash anymore.
Rather, the unique ID is mapped at 0x00000000. This is unfortuantely
also where the exception vector table is stored.

EEFC_ReadUniqueID() is already linked to RAM, which is good.  Hoewver,
if an Interrupt happens between STUI and SPUI, then we try to access
the vector table and code from flash, which is illegal.  We run into
a hardfault and stay there until the watchdog resets the processor.

Kevin Redon b6e2f0f8e7 DFU: add DFU application
this adds the DFU as application, allowing to flash the bootloader.
a USB DFU alternative is added to flash the bootloader partition.

when the DFU is started as bootloader, the partition/alternative
to flash the bootloader is marked as "not available", and
ineffective.
the same happens for the application partition when DFU is started
as application.

this distinction is make at compile time, not at runtime, because
of size restrictions (the bootloader was already close to the
16 kB limit).
*_dfu_flash.bin should not be mixed with *_dfu_dfu.bin.
*_dfu_dfu.bin should be flashed as application using the already
existing DFU bootloader.
once this images is started (as application), the *_dfu_flash.bin
should be flashed as bootloader using the DFU application.

once the DFU bootloader has been flashed, soft resetting
(not re-powering) will cause the bootloader to start, allowing to
flash the application with a normal image (e.g. not DFU),
replacing the DFU application.
this switch to DFU only happens after downloading (e.g. flashing).

it is planned to have the DFU application erase itself after
flashing, but this is currently not implemented.
